Lamps Plus - Home Theater Lighting

The key feature of home theater lighting is centralized control. Wireless controls are a great option. You can easily set them up with your existing lighting scheme.
Then you need two types of lighting, ambient and task.
For ambient (all-over, indirect) illumination try twin torchieres. If you have molding or high cabinets then try rope lights. You can tuck them into a variety of spaces. Sconces are also a great space saver.
Direct, strong lighting is essential for reading and other tasks. Both table and floor lamps can be ideal for this. Try a combination torchiere for an all-in-one solution.
